Lundgren+Lindqvist translate a Roman metaphor into a precise visual system rooted in duality. The logomark, interrupted rectangles and elliptical cuts, reveals an elegant letter I. Typography, grid, and space align with mathematical rigor, creating a resilient digital-first identity. Its restraint proves confidence, every element feels intentional and earned. The palette shifts from black to transitional grey, punctuated by a sharp green that signals growth and foresight. Split compositions and interactive frames make the site feel like a conversation between past and future.
